What do you mean a "pre-cursor"???

R.B. 05-12-2008 02:24 AM

HI Unregistered,

Yes you are right this is a half finished sentence presuming knowledge, and not very clear.

Sorry I was in a rush.

COX2 is an enzyme which is used to make two separate families of chemicals one from long chain omega 6 fat and one from omega 3 fat.

The omega six chemicals produced are in very general terms inflammatory.

An imbalance of Omega 3 and 6 with excess of Omega 6 arguably leads to inflammatory pressures in the body.

In the sense omega 6 is a raw material of inflammatory chemicals it is a precursor - less raw material = less product.

There is more information in the Greek Diet thread which is primarily about omega 3 and 6.
